NPD: Xbox 360 tops console sales in January
Xbox 360 was the top selling console in the US in January, according to NPD data provided by Microsoft.
"Sustained consumer demand for Kinect helped propel Xbox 360" to 381,000 sales, up 48,000 over January 2010, the platform holder said in a statement.
Microsoft also said NPD data showed total retail spend on Xbox 360 exceeded $551 million in January, making it the No.1 selling console platform for the tenth month in a row.
"Some lingering supply constraints coupled with high consumer demand led to continued pockets of shortages at retail," the firm claimed.
"Microsoft anticipates this trend to improve through February, but will continue to work with retail and manufacturing partners to expedite production and shipments."
Sony and Nintendo have yet to release any monthly platform sales figures, but well update this story if the numbers are made available.
Call of Duty: Black Ops was the No.1 game in January, while Dead Space 2, LittleBigPlanet 2 and DC Universe Online debuted on the software top ten chart.
